One cup of Chicken spring rolls is around 250 grams and contains approximately 375 calories, 20 grams of protein, 12.5 grams of fat, and 50 grams of carbohydrates.
Chicken Spring Rolls are a delicious fusion of tender, seasoned chicken and crisp vegetables, all wrapped in a light, delicate rice paper. Originating from Southeast Asian cuisine, these rolls are typically served with a zesty dipping sauce that enhances their fresh flavors. Packed with protein and fiber, Chicken Spring Rolls offer a healthy snack or appetizer option, contributing to a balanced diet. While they can be deep-fried for an extra crunch, opting for a fresh, steamed version keeps them light and nutritious, making them perfect for any occasion.
